After coming under pressure early in the session, stocks saw further downside over the course of the trading day on Thursday. The major averages all moved sharply lower as the day progressed, more than offsetting the modest gains posted during Wednesday’s session.

The major averages ended the day not far off their lows of the session. The Dow tumbled 703.84 points or 1.3 percent to 52,759.21, the Nasdaq slumped 263.92 points or 1 percent to 26,067.17 and the S&P 500 slid 66.82 points or 0.9 percent to 7,641.16.
